On February 20, 2016 Montgomery Catholic Preparatory School’s elementary Science Olympiad team competed against 33 other schools in Jacksonville, Ala.. The team, from both...
Montgomery Catholic Preparatory School had a great day at the annual District VI Alabama Bandmasters Association Musical Performance Assessment(MPA) held on March...
Montgomery Catholic Preparatory School proudly announces the 2016-17 Marching Knights Leadership and Color Guard. MCPS Band Director Alex Johnson said “We had...